Mythical Games Raises $150M in Series C Funding Led by Andreessen Horowitz at $1.25B Valuation

Investment Will Usher in New Age of Innovation in Player Ownership and Virtual Collection, Bringing Play-to-Earn Videogames into the Mainstream via the Mythical Platform

LOS ANGELES--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Following a Series B raise of $75 million less than four months ago, Mythical Games, a next-generation gaming technology studio, today announced a $150 million Series C financing led by Andreessen Horowitz, bringing the company valuation to $1.25 billion and reflecting Mythical’s dramatic growth and success in bringing play-to-earn concepts and playable NFTs to the mainstream in 2021. The Series C funding includes participation from D1 Capital, RedBird Capital, and The Raine Group, as well as crypto exchanges Binance and FTX. The company also received support from notable entertainment brands and personalities including 32 Equity, the investment arm of the National Football League (NFL); The Chainsmokers' Mantis VC; Ryan Tedder (OneRepublic); OneTeam Partners; and pro-sports team owners including Jonathan Kraft and The Kraft Group (New England Patriots and New England Revolution); Michael Gordon (Fenway Sports Group; Boston Red Sox and Liverpool FC); and Michael Jordan & Curtis Polk (Hornet Sports & Entertainment; Charlotte Hornets and NASCAR Cup race team 23XI Racing).

“As an early believer / investor in blockchain technology & NFTs, and as a much earlier believer in video games, I am happy to help back a company that understands not only where the world is at with gaming and tech, but where it’s headed,” said Ryan Tedder of OneRepublic. “I’m also excited to explore the many ways in which music will play an important role in this next evolution of the games industry.”

Existing investors including Galaxy Interactive, WestCap, 01 Advisors, Javelin Partners, Struck Capital, Alumni Ventures and Signum Growth Investments invested further in the Series C as well, bringing the total raised by Mythical to over $270 million (of which $225 million was raised in 2021). Mythical Games will use the funding to continue growing its team and effectively scaling out operations as it funds future games and brings new game developers to the Mythical Platform, a full-service system to build or integrate playable NFT-based economies into their games, increasing engagement and unlocking new business models by allowing players to become stakeholders in their favorite games. The first developer partners to the platform, Creative Mobile, CCG Lab and Abstraction Games, were announced earlier this week.

Games on the Mythical Platform unlock the value of a player’s monetary and time-based efforts, or the rarity of their collection, by providing a way for them to sell their digital assets to other players for real money, in safe and secure transactions on the Mythical Marketplace.

About Mythical Games

Acknowledged by Forbes’ Disruptive Technology Companies To Watch in 2019 and Fast Company’s World Changing Ideas 2021, Mythical is a next-generation games technology company creating a universal gaming ecosystem by leveraging blockchain technology and playable NFTs for tools that enable players, creators, artists, brands and game developers to become stakeholders and owners in new play-to-earn game economies.

Led by gaming industry veterans, the team specializes in building games around player-owned economies and has helped develop major franchises including Call of Duty, World of Warcraft, Guitar Hero, DJ Hero, Marvel Strike Force and Skylanders.

The Mythical Platform is built on an EVM-compatible sidechain using a Proof of Authority consensus model that is more environmentally friendly and sustainable than the Proof of Work model. Minting NFTs and integrating the Marketplace via the Mythical Platform do not require any mining or cryptocurrency to operate, or for players to participate.
